The Automotive Composites Market Size was valued at USD 7.1 billion in 2023 and is expected to reach USD 19.5 billion by 2032 and grow at a CAGR of 11.9% over the forecast period 2024-2032.
The Automotive Composites Market is driven by the increasing demand for lightweight, fuel-efficient, and high-performance vehicles. Automotive composites, including carbon fiber, glass fiber, and natural fiber composites, are widely used in body panels, interior components, structural reinforcements, and under-the-hood applications. With stringent emissions regulations and the push for electric vehicles (EVs), automakers are turning to composite materials to enhance vehicle strength, durability, and energy efficiency.

Future Scope
The Automotive Composites Market is expected to grow rapidly due to rising vehicle electrification, increasing regulatory pressure for carbon footprint reduction, and advancements in composite manufacturing technologies. The Asia-Pacific region, led by China and India, is projected to dominate the market due to expanding automotive production, government incentives for EVs, and investment in sustainable materials. Additionally, advancements in recycling technology for composite materials will further drive market expansion.
Emerging Trends
The market is seeing a shift toward high-performance carbon fiber composites, particularly in EVs and luxury vehicles, to enhance strength while reducing weight. Thermoplastic composites are gaining popularity due to their recyclability, impact resistance, and faster processing times. The integration of 3D printing technology is revolutionizing composite manufacturing, allowing for customized, high-precision components. Furthermore, the use of natural fiber composites (e.g., hemp, flax, kenaf) is increasing due to the growing focus on sustainability and biodegradable materials.
